How do you analyze data and valid conclusions?

To analyze data and draw valid conclusions, I first ensure the data is clean and relevant, identifying any biases or errors. I then apply appropriate statistical methods and tools to interpret the data, looking for patterns, correlations, or trends. Finally, I validate conclusions by cross-referencing findings with existing literature or conducting further tests, ensuring that any claims are supported by robust evidence and logical reasoning.

Is rhetorical appeal that includes facts figures scientific data and statistics?

Yes, rhetorical appeal that includes facts, figures, scientific data, and statistics is known as logos. Logos refers to logical reasoning and the use of evidence to support an argument, making it a crucial element in persuasive communication. By incorporating factual information, a speaker or writer can enhance their credibility and effectively persuade the audience through rational arguments.

What is a valid scientific argument?

A valid scientific argument is one that is based on empirical evidence, logical reasoning, and adheres to the principles of the scientific method. It typically involves formulating a hypothesis, conducting experiments or observations to gather data, and drawing conclusions that are supported by the evidence. Additionally, a valid scientific argument should be reproducible and open to peer review, allowing others in the scientific community to evaluate and verify the findings. Importantly, it must also be falsifiable, meaning that it can be tested and potentially disproven.


What is the scientific definition for valid?

In scientific contexts, "valid" refers to the soundness and accuracy of a method, argument, or conclusion based on empirical evidence and logical reasoning. A valid experiment or study is one that effectively tests its hypothesis, ensuring that the results genuinely reflect the phenomenon being investigated. Validity also encompasses the degree to which a measurement accurately represents what it intends to measure. Thus, a valid scientific claim is supported by reliable data and appropriate methodologies.

What does valid means in scientific terms?

A conclusion or assertion would be considered to be scientifically valid if the data are accurate and the reasoning based on that data is, as far as we can tell, correctly reasoned. Science does not deal in absolute truth, which is why scientists prefer the term valid, which indicates that as far as we presently know, this statement is true, although new data and/or new reasoning may cause us to change our minds in the future.
